But I said to you, “You will possess their land; I will give it to you as an inheritance, a land flowing with milk and honey.” I am the Lord your God, who has set you apart from the nations. Leviticus 20:24 (NIV)

Set Apart for God… Sometimes, I feel insecure and want to be like other women I know. It might be their hairstyle, clothes, jewelry, or even how great their makeup looks.

It causes me to buy more than one foundation because I want my skin to look like the women in social media ads. OR buy another such something to allow me to curl my hair so that I can have those cute beach waves like so many other women I see. Even when I know it’s silly, I still do.

My friend Stacey looks cute in the little sweaters she wears in the winter when we meet for coffee. When I leave, I think about how I need cardigans like hers so that I can look better than the cozy sweatshirt I schlepped on because I wanted to be warm. I forget how much I love my cozy sweatshirts and why I wear them sometimes.

I love my friend Linda’s jewelry and any outfit she wears anytime we get together. She knows just the right thing to wear for any occasion. I worry about how I show up sometimes and don’t seem to get the memo about how I should dress. I’m underdressed or overdressed, but I’m thankful I get it right occasionally.

I wonder if anyone ever looks at me and wants to be like me and thinks they never would. Then, the Lord reminds me of the woman who shared how she wished she could pray like I do and another woman who wanted advice about how to pray while raising her small children.

I remember having a sweet conversation with them both to encourage them in their prayer lives. It allowed me to guide them in their walk with the Lord. Both opportunities bring me so much joy; they really do.

This has made me realize that it’s not Linda’s jewelry that I admire so much but how I know she would go out of her way to be there for me if I needed her. It’s not Stacey’s sweaters that I love so much but how she has pursued me as a friend, which gives us so many opportunities to meet and talk about scripture.

Then it makes me think about one of my dearest friends, Mendy, and how good she is to me and good for me as a sister in Christ. Mendy is so caring, kind, and selfless, which makes me want to be like Christ, who lives in her.

Lee Ann is another wonderful friend who prays with me weekly for the church we both attend and the Billy Graham Evangelistic Association for which we both volunteer. We all want a faithful friend we can call and pray with; I would have to include both of my sisters, Lisa and Saroya, as prayer partners, too. I’m grateful for every single one of these women and many others I know because they know and love the Lord.

God has been using this lately to remind me that my desire should be for Him. It should be set apart for God and His Kingdom, His glory, and nothing else. At the end of the day, nothing matters in my life more than Him. This is His desire for me and is still my heart’s desire.

Set Apart, Bible Study and coffee with friends

This is my prayer for you, too: that your greatest desire is for Him. I pray that God will break your heart for what breaks His. I pray that you and I will stop letting the little foxes into our lives that keep us from loving Him well, putting Him first, and leaning on Him before anyone else. He wants to be our first love but will never force Himself on any one of us. That is how much He loves us. He gives us the choice and opportunity to come to Him. Set us apart for You, God.
